    Darragh Malony and RTE

    I was sickened tonight by RTE's coverange of the Champions League. Last season RTE used to show a game and then show highlights of the other games. One of those games would get extensive highlights.

    As a result I watched RTE's coverage of Man Utd V Lyon and thought to myself I would watch the highlights of Milan V Arsenal and Barca V Celtic and the goals of Seville V Fenerbache.

    However Darragh "Unbelievable" Maloney decides to tell me the scores of the other games during the Man Utd game.

    All this does is make me less likely to stay up and watch RTE's coverage of the other games. What is the point in him telling us the scores. If people want to know the score there are many ways to find out they dont need them to put the scoreup on the screen and for Darragh Maloney to go and tell us also. I was fuming and if anybody else is annoyed with this I urge you to e mail

    complaints@rte.ie

    I think RTE will lose viewers if they continue with this policy of telling us the score both in visual and aural format during the game in order to make it unavoidable.

    Dear Neil



    Many thanks for your comments below. We have received quite a few complaints from viewers about this.

    As a result we will be looking again at our policy on this for the quarter-finals and beyond.



    Kind regards,



    Stephen Alkin

    Exec Producer RTE TV Sport
